Q: Is 255,532,018 a Prime Number?
A: No, 255,532,018 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 255532018 can be evenly divided by 1 2 7 14 18,252,287 36,504,574 127,766,009 and 255,532,018, with no remainder.
Since 255,532,018 cannot be divided by just 1 and 255,532,018, it is not a prime number.
